Clinton Global Initiative | 2022 Meeting

September 19-20, 2022 |
New York, NY

Everest Group’s Rita N. Soni, Principal Analyst for Impact Sourcing and Sustainability, will contribute sustainability learning to the Clinton Global Initiative meeting on September 19-20 in New York City.

This two-day event will spotlight challenges of global proportion, like inclusive economic recovery and growth. The platform aims to bring together global and emerging leaders from heads of states to social justice warriors to industry stalwarts in order to take collaborative action and address the world’s most pressing challenges.

Rita will be working alongside colleagues and global stakeholders to discuss impact sourcing, the potential it provides to companies and underserved communities around the world, and initiatives to help companies incorporate impact sourcing into their business models
